Rather than regenerating the entire site, Pagewright computes a dependency graph of templates, content files, and data sources, then rebuilds only affected pages. From a security standpoint, note that the rebuild worker runs with write access to the publish bucket, and cache invalidation messages are signed by the Keyline service. Please review the trust boundaries carefully. The full rebuild architecture and signing details are documented at the internal page below.

wiki page, fahaf-yagag: https://confluence.qorvellabs.internal/pages/display/pages/display

Subject: DR drill — Tilecourier prefetcher restore

Hi reviewer,

During Thursday's disaster-recovery drill we will rebuild the Tilecourier prefetcher from cold backups in the Norrel standby region. Please review the restore runbook carefully before sign-off, since the queue replay step is new. To decrypt the backup snapshot, use the recovery passphrase below.

unlock words, kajeg-fahif: holmir-casael-novdor

Briefing: Second-Source Supplier Search — For the Incoming Director

Welcome aboard. Quick context: we currently rely on Tovaric Components for nearly all housings on the Brightline series, and that single-source exposure has bitten us twice this year. Procurement has shortlisted three alternatives — Quenmar Plastics, Ostveld Moulding, and a smaller shop near Darrowfield. Quenmar looks strongest on price, Ostveld on lead time. We'd like your steer before final visits. The confidential note below explains where this fits strategically.

board note of bawep-tajef: Queniusek Systems plans to raise the Quenvan list price by 53.1 percent in March. The pricing group signed off on a budget of $176.4 million for Project Drueth. The renewal with Casionix Partners closes at $142.5 million a year, 8.3 percent below the last contract. Project Fraax slips by six weeks because of the tooling delay.

### 2.8.0 — Key rotation

While sharding the Lumenfolk user-profile store into four regions, we rotated the signing credentials so each shard migrator validates its own manifests. Old keys are revoked as of this release. For audit purposes, the newly issued key used by the shard tooling is included below.

deploy key for kajof-fajop: bky6_gDHw9Q